About

Franck Cazaurang is a scholar working on Control and Systems Engineering, Aerospace Engineering and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ition. According to data from OpenAlex, Franck Cazaurang has authored 27 papers receiving a total of 190 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Control and Systems Engineering, 12 papers in Aerospace Engineering and 3 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ition. Recurrent topics in Franck Cazaurang’s work include Spacecraft Dynamics and Control (8 papers), Adaptive Control of Nonlinear Systems (7 papers) and Fault Detection and Control Systems (7 papers). Franck Cazaurang is often cited by papers focused on Spacecraft Dynamics and Control (8 papers), Adaptive Control of Nonlinear Systems (7 papers) and Fault Detection and Control Systems (7 papers). Franck Cazaurang coll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and Mexico. Franck Cazaurang's co-authors include Ali Zolghadri, Christophe Louembet, C. Charbonnel, Christelle Pittet, Marcel Staroswiecki, Tudor-Bogdan Airimiţoaie, Jean Lévine, Manish Kumar, Pierre Melchior and Kelly Cohen and has published in prestigious journals such as Automatica, Environmental Modelling & Software and Systems & Control Letters.
